diff options
author | Ross Schlaikjer <ross@schlaikjer.net> | 2020-04-07 14:11:02 -0400 |
---|---|---|
committer | Ross Schlaikjer <ross@schlaikjer.net> | 2020-04-07 14:11:49 -0400 |
commit | 3257bdc8a15077e8e8ad9285f98e8d9e1e5cae07 (patch) | |
tree | 29d4f6023fbbfa14b41ff0fb0450ab261fbda246 /ecp5/archdefs.h | |
parent | 0bdf1e05f126e01adcea3f11d1d76f3235ab44e8 (diff) | |
download | nextpnr-3257bdc8a15077e8e8ad9285f98e8d9e1e5cae07.tar.gz nextpnr-3257bdc8a15077e8e8ad9285f98e8d9e1e5cae07.tar.bz2 nextpnr-3257bdc8a15077e8e8ad9285f98e8d9e1e5cae07.zip |
Actually just move all the logic to ArchInfo
Diffstat (limited to 'ecp5/archdefs.h')
-rw-r--r-- | ecp5/archdefs.h | 10 |
1 files changed, 8 insertions, 2 deletions
diff --git a/ecp5/archdefs.h b/ecp5/archdefs.h index 5312045c..0f197345 100644 --- a/ecp5/archdefs.h +++ b/ecp5/archdefs.h @@ -180,8 +180,14 @@ struct ArchCellInfo struct { bool is_pdp; - bool output_a_registered; - bool output_b_registered; + // Are the outputs from a DP16KD registered (OUTREG) + // or non-registered (NOREG) + bool is_output_a_registered; + bool is_output_b_registered; + // Which timing information to use for a DP16KD. Depends on registering + // configuration. + nextpnr_ecp5::IdString regmode_timing_id; + } ramInfo; }; |